I am strongly debating which route to take for my old built house without neutral wire in my switches. I was almost determined to go with RA2 Select, and completed online course, ordered Main Repeater and RRD-6CL switch. As I plan my first wiring, I wanted to make sure using the compatible/best LED. I then realized following two potential issues with RA2 Select option.
1. 6CL has no direct writing in regarding to LED minimum load. It says 50W for MLV, but I am fairly certain that's not the case for LED as most LED aren't that high. In fact, on Amazon it says 5W. However, one contradiction is RA2 Essential App when designing takes out 6CL from its valid option if I entire LED light wattage as 9W.
2. List of supported LED on RRD-6CL is extremely small when compared to counterpart Caseta dimmer without Neutral wire requirement. Considering RRD-6CL is so much more expansive (3x), is it real that this device has far smaller LED compatiblity?
49 to 95 device support, potential upgrade to Radio 2, and more supported devices including motion sensor are all great, but fundamental lack of LED support seems a major downside of RA2 system when it comes to simple dimmer option. Am I correct on this?
